What do you need to bring?
- Proof of U.S. Citizenship
- Proof of Identity (Current driver’s license preferred)
- Know the birthdates of your parents, city, state/country of birth, and mother’s maiden name.
- Two checks or money orders
- Passport Application Fee: $67.00 (made payable to the U. S. Department of State)
- Passport Execution Fee: $30.00 (made payable to Temple University)
- Two passport-type photos. $20.00 (made payable to the International Business Association)
We will have a photographer available, with the required camera and film.
(Sorry, no cash/credit cards. You can buy a money order from 7-11 on Liacouras Walk)

PASSPORT PROCESSING TIME
Routine Processing ($97.00 fee): According to the National Passport Information Center website, “Routine Service passports are received within six weeks.” http://travel.state.gov/passport/get/processing/processing_1740.html
Expedited Processing ($60.00 fee in addition to the routine application fee of $67.00 and the execution fee of $30.00): The National Passport Information Center website states, “Expedite Service takes two weeks to receive your passport from the date you applied.” http://travel.state.gov/passport/get/processing/processing_1740.html
